diff --git a/lib/zinc/poly1305/poly1305.c b/lib/zinc/poly1305/poly1305.c
new file mode 100644
index 000000000000..fd662dec9225
--- /dev/null
+++ b/lib/zinc/poly1305/poly1305.c
@@ -0,0 +1,291 @@
+/* SPDX-License-Identifier: BSD-3-Clause OR GPL-2.0
+ *
+ * Copyright (C) 2015-2018 Jason A. Donenfeld <ja...@zx2c4.com>. All Rights 
Reserved.
+ * Copyright (C) 2006-2017 CRYPTOGAMS by <ap...@openssl.org>. All Rights 
Reserved.
+ *
+ * This is based in part on Andy Polyakov's implementation from CRYPTOGAMS.
+ *
+ * Implementation of the Poly1305 message authenticator.
+ *
+ * Information: https://cr.yp.to/mac.html
+ */
+
+#include <zinc/poly1305.h>
+
+#include <asm/unaligned.h>
+#include <linux/kernel.h>
+#include <linux/string.h>
+
+#ifndef HAVE_POLY1305_ARCH_IMPLEMENTATION
+static inline bool poly1305_init_arch(void *ctx,
+                                     const u8 key[POLY1305_KEY_SIZE],
+                                     simd_context_t simd_context)
+{
+       return false;
+}
+static inline bool poly1305_blocks_arch(void *ctx, const u8 *inp,
+                                       const size_t len, const u32 padbit,
+                                       simd_context_t simd_context)
+{
+       return false;
+}
+static inline bool poly1305_emit_arch(void *ctx, u8 mac[POLY1305_MAC_SIZE],
+                                     const u32 nonce[4],
+                                     simd_context_t simd_context)
+{
+       return false;
+}
+void __init poly1305_fpu_init(void)
+{
+}
+#endif
+
+struct poly1305_internal {
+       u32 h[5];
+       u32 r[4];
+};
+
+static void poly1305_init_generic(void *ctx, const u8 key[16])
+{
+       struct poly1305_internal *st = (struct poly1305_internal *)ctx;
+
+       /* h = 0 */
+       st->h[0] = 0;
+       st->h[1] = 0;
+       st->h[2] = 0;
+       st->h[3] = 0;
+       st->h[4] = 0;
+
+       /* r &= 0xffffffc0ffffffc0ffffffc0fffffff */
+       st->r[0] = get_unaligned_le32(&key[ 0]) & 0x0fffffff;
+       st->r[1] = get_unaligned_le32(&key[ 4]) & 0x0ffffffc;
+       st->r[2] = get_unaligned_le32(&key[ 8]) & 0x0ffffffc;
+       st->r[3] = get_unaligned_le32(&key[12]) & 0x0ffffffc;
+}
+
+static void poly1305_blocks_generic(void *ctx, const u8 *inp, size_t len,
+                                   const u32 padbit)
+{
+#define CONSTANT_TIME_CARRY(a, b)                                              
\
+       ((a ^ ((a ^ b) | ((a - b) ^ b))) >> (sizeof(a) * 8 - 1))
+       struct poly1305_internal *st = (struct poly1305_internal *)ctx;
+       u32 r0, r1, r2, r3;
+       u32 s1, s2, s3;
+       u32 h0, h1, h2, h3, h4, c;
+       u64 d0, d1, d2, d3;
+
+       r0 = st->r[0];
+       r1 = st->r[1];
+       r2 = st->r[2];
+       r3 = st->r[3];
+
+       s1 = r1 + (r1 >> 2);
+       s2 = r2 + (r2 >> 2);
+       s3 = r3 + (r3 >> 2);
+
+       h0 = st->h[0];
+       h1 = st->h[1];
+       h2 = st->h[2];
+       h3 = st->h[3];
+       h4 = st->h[4];
+
+       while (len >= POLY1305_BLOCK_SIZE) {
+               /* h += m[i] */
+               h0 = (u32)(d0 = (u64)h0 + (0       ) + get_unaligned_le32(&inp[ 
0]));
+               h1 = (u32)(d1 = (u64)h1 + (d0 >> 32) + get_unaligned_le32(&inp[ 
4]));
+               h2 = (u32)(d2 = (u64)h2 + (d1 >> 32) + get_unaligned_le32(&inp[ 
8]));
+               h3 = (u32)(d3 = (u64)h3 + (d2 >> 32) + 
get_unaligned_le32(&inp[12]));
+               h4 += (u32)(d3 >> 32) + padbit;
+
+               /* h *= r "%" p, where "%" stands for "partial remainder" */
+               d0 = ((u64)h0 * r0) +
+                    ((u64)h1 * s3) +
+                    ((u64)h2 * s2) +
+                    ((u64)h3 * s1);
+               d1 = ((u64)h0 * r1) +
+                    ((u64)h1 * r0) +
+                    ((u64)h2 * s3) +
+                    ((u64)h3 * s2) +
+                    (h4 * s1);
+               d2 = ((u64)h0 * r2) +
+                    ((u64)h1 * r1) +
+                    ((u64)h2 * r0) +
+                    ((u64)h3 * s3) +
+                    (h4 * s2);
+               d3 = ((u64)h0 * r3) +
+                    ((u64)h1 * r2) +
+                    ((u64)h2 * r1) +
+                    ((u64)h3 * r0) +
+                    (h4 * s3);
+               h4 = (h4 * r0);
+
+               /* last reduction step: */
+               /* a) h4:h0 = h4<<128 + d3<<96 + d2<<64 + d1<<32 + d0 */
+               h0 = (u32)d0;
+               h1 = (u32)(d1 += d0 >> 32);
+               h2 = (u32)(d2 += d1 >> 32);
+               h3 = (u32)(d3 += d2 >> 32);
+               h4 += (u32)(d3 >> 32);
+               /* b) (h4:h0 += (h4:h0>>130) * 5) %= 2^130 */
+               c = (h4 >> 2) + (h4 & ~3U);
+               h4 &= 3;
+               h0 += c;
+               h1 += (c = CONSTANT_TIME_CARRY(h0, c));
+               h2 += (c = CONSTANT_TIME_CARRY(h1, c));
+               h3 += (c = CONSTANT_TIME_CARRY(h2, c));
+               h4 += CONSTANT_TIME_CARRY(h3, c);
+               /*
+                * Occasional overflows to 3rd bit of h4 are taken care of
+                * "naturally". If after this point we end up at the top of
+                * this loop, then the overflow bit will be accounted for
+                * in next iteration. If we end up in poly1305_emit, then
+                * comparison to modulus below will still count as "carry
+                * into 131st bit", so that properly reduced value will be
+                * picked in conditional move.
+                */
+
+               inp += POLY1305_BLOCK_SIZE;
+               len -= POLY1305_BLOCK_SIZE;
+       }
+
+       st->h[0] = h0;
+       st->h[1] = h1;
+       st->h[2] = h2;
+       st->h[3] = h3;
+       st->h[4] = h4;
+#undef CONSTANT_TIME_CARRY
+}
+
+static void poly1305_emit_generic(void *ctx, u8 mac[16], const u32 nonce[4])
+{
+       struct poly1305_internal *st = (struct poly1305_internal *)ctx;
+       u32 h0, h1, h2, h3, h4;
+       u32 g0, g1, g2, g3, g4;
+       u64 t;
+       u32 mask;
+
+       h0 = st->h[0];
+       h1 = st->h[1];
+       h2 = st->h[2];
+       h3 = st->h[3];
+       h4 = st->h[4];
+
+       /* compare to modulus by computing h + -p */
+       g0 = (u32)(t = (u64)h0 + 5);
+       g1 = (u32)(t = (u64)h1 + (t >> 32));
+       g2 = (u32)(t = (u64)h2 + (t >> 32));
+       g3 = (u32)(t = (u64)h3 + (t >> 32));
+       g4 = h4 + (u32)(t >> 32);
+
+       /* if there was carry into 131st bit, h3:h0 = g3:g0 */
+       mask = 0 - (g4 >> 2);
+       g0 &= mask;
+       g1 &= mask;
+       g2 &= mask;
+       g3 &= mask;
+       mask = ~mask;
+       h0 = (h0 & mask) | g0;
+       h1 = (h1 & mask) | g1;
+       h2 = (h2 & mask) | g2;
+       h3 = (h3 & mask) | g3;
+
+       /* mac = (h + nonce) % (2^128) */
+       h0 = (u32)(t = (u64)h0 + nonce[0]);
+       h1 = (u32)(t = (u64)h1 + (t >> 32) + nonce[1]);
+       h2 = (u32)(t = (u64)h2 + (t >> 32) + nonce[2]);
+       h3 = (u32)(t = (u64)h3 + (t >> 32) + nonce[3]);
+
+       put_unaligned_le32(h0, &mac[ 0]);
+       put_unaligned_le32(h1, &mac[ 4]);
+       put_unaligned_le32(h2, &mac[ 8]);
+       put_unaligned_le32(h3, &mac[12]);
+}
+
+void poly1305_init(struct poly1305_ctx *ctx, const u8 key[POLY1305_KEY_SIZE],
+                  simd_context_t simd_context)
+{
+       ctx->nonce[0] = get_unaligned_le32(&key[16]);
+       ctx->nonce[1] = get_unaligned_le32(&key[20]);
+       ctx->nonce[2] = get_unaligned_le32(&key[24]);
+       ctx->nonce[3] = get_unaligned_le32(&key[28]);
+
+       if (!poly1305_init_arch(ctx->opaque, key, simd_context))
+               poly1305_init_generic(ctx->opaque, key);
+       ctx->num = 0;
+}
+EXPORT_SYMBOL(poly1305_init);
+
+static inline void poly1305_blocks(void *ctx, const u8 *inp, const size_t len,
+                                  const u32 padbit,
+                                  simd_context_t simd_context)
+{
+       if (!poly1305_blocks_arch(ctx, inp, len, padbit, simd_context))
+               poly1305_blocks_generic(ctx, inp, len, padbit);
+}
+
+static inline void poly1305_emit(void *ctx, u8 mac[POLY1305_KEY_SIZE],
+                                const u32 nonce[4],
+                                simd_context_t simd_context)
+{
+       if (!poly1305_emit_arch(ctx, mac, nonce, simd_context))
+               poly1305_emit_generic(ctx, mac, nonce);
+}
+
+void poly1305_update(struct poly1305_ctx *ctx, const u8 *inp, size_t len,
+                    simd_context_t simd_context)
+{
+       const size_t num = ctx->num % POLY1305_BLOCK_SIZE;
+       size_t rem;
+
+       if (num) {
+               rem = POLY1305_BLOCK_SIZE - num;
+               if (len >= rem) {
+                       memcpy(ctx->data + num, inp, rem);
+                       poly1305_blocks(ctx->opaque, ctx->data,
+                                       POLY1305_BLOCK_SIZE, 1, simd_context);
+                       inp += rem;
+                       len -= rem;
+               } else {
+                       /* Still not enough data to process a block. */
+                       memcpy(ctx->data + num, inp, len);
+                       ctx->num = num + len;
+                       return;
+               }
+       }
+
+       rem = len % POLY1305_BLOCK_SIZE;
+       len -= rem;
+
+       if (len >= POLY1305_BLOCK_SIZE) {
+               poly1305_blocks(ctx->opaque, inp, len, 1, simd_context);
+               inp += len;
+       }
+
+       if (rem)
+               memcpy(ctx->data, inp, rem);
+
+       ctx->num = rem;
+}
+EXPORT_SYMBOL(poly1305_update);
+
+void poly1305_finish(struct poly1305_ctx *ctx, u8 mac[POLY1305_MAC_SIZE],
+                    simd_context_t simd_context)
+{
+       size_t num = ctx->num % POLY1305_BLOCK_SIZE;
+
+       if (num) {
+               ctx->data[num++] = 1; /* pad bit */
+               while (num < POLY1305_BLOCK_SIZE)
+                       ctx->data[num++] = 0;
+               poly1305_blocks(ctx->opaque, ctx->data, POLY1305_BLOCK_SIZE, 0,
+                               simd_context);
+       }
+
+       poly1305_emit(ctx->opaque, mac, ctx->nonce, simd_context);
+
+       /* zero out the state */
+       memzero_explicit(ctx, sizeof(*ctx));
+}
+EXPORT_SYMBOL(poly1305_finish);
+
+#include "../selftest/poly1305.h"
